about

Produced and recorded during quarantine, Pyramid Song is a dream of intimacy at a time of isolation. With swirling soundscapes, ardent vocals, and cacophonous samples, Roxanna’s interpretation of Radiohead’s music provides an illusory aspiration for a better world beyond.

credits

released July 6, 2020

Arranged, produced, and performed by Roxanna Walitzki
Music & Lyrics by Radiohead; Colin Greenwood, Ed O'brien, Jonny Greenwood, Phil Selway, And Thom Yorke

Roxanna Seattle, Washington

Roxanna integrates experimental elements from electronic and ambient music into her arrangements of classical songs, producing a delicate world of imagined-sound to match her uniquely ethereal aesthetic.
